Our analysis looked at 501 schools in the United States offering Public Administration programs. To create this ranking we looked at how many students graduated from each school’s program.

The following schools top our list of the Most Popular Public Administration Schools.

The most popular school in the United States for Public Administration students is Indiana University-Bloomington. Indiana University-Bloomington is a public school located in Bloomington, IN. During the most recent year for which we have data, 556 people earned their degree in Public Administration from this school. Graduates of this program go on to a median salary of $48,621.
